South Hadley's recreation centerpiece on Route 33, with a band shell, two pavilions, a skate park, pickleball and basketball courts, a spray park and a flat walking loop with a disc golf course threaded through it. It draws crowds for the town's seasonal events.

Is the spray park open every day in summer?
It opens weekends-only from Memorial Day weekend through mid-June, then runs daily until Labor Day, 10:30am to 6:30pm.
